Output d37c24aec82ad85aafba21ae458425be96387698a010648ba87f361bfc621995:1

value
3814220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5af6688c3a95972f7ae8a0a3092004112f4faa36b0faaa245ff1b309f69185e4
address
bc1pttmx3rp6jktj77hg5z3sjgqyzyh5l23kkra25fzl7xesna53shjq5afxur
transaction
d37c24aec82ad85aafba21ae458425be96387698a010648ba87f361bfc621995
spent
true